The Washington Times—N.Y. judge upholds Trump $175 million civil fraud bond. New York Judge Arthur Engoron ruled Monday that the $175 million bond posted by former President Donald Trump for his civil fraud case can stand.

USA Today—Judge approves safeguards for Donald Trump's $175 million civil business fraud appeal bond. A New York judge approved an agreement Monday to strengthen the $175 million bond in Donald Trump's civil fraud case while he appeals.
